We included the Robert Lewandowski to Liverpool story from this morning in our ‘Nonsense transfer rumour of the day‘ section, but now his agent has discussed a potential transfer it has (very slightly) more credence…

Early this Tuesday afternoon, quotes have been released from Maik Barthel, the Polish striker’s German agent which are at least worth of re-reporting.

“It would be wrong to say there is no interest,” he told SportBild, cited in the Echo.

“I think it would have to be a very high offer, definitely higher than £35m.”

Surely Barthel’s claim of £35m is a tremendous understatement in today’s prices. During the summer Raheem Sterling went for £49m and Rotation centre-half Nicolas Otamendi went for £32m – so we cannot imagine a striker who starts up top for arguably the world’s best club team right now, having scored 19 goals so far this season, wouldn’t go for at least double that.

We’re not holding our breath on this one, but at least find it interesting that Barthel is touting his client’s services around.

Still, with Sergio Aguero perpetually injured for City, Manchester United in desperate need of a centre-forward and Diego Costa out of form for Chelsea – it’s probably unlikely we’re the aforementioned English side anyway.
